Latest Patents

Morizio's latest patents focus on the creation of microporous and ultrafine PTFE membranes that exhibit high permeability, excellent mechanical strength, and good chemical inertness. The first patent describes a method for preparing a porous PTFE membrane by compressing a porous PTFE substrate to achieve a smaller pore rating. This innovative approach allows for the incorporation of fibrous sheets during the compression process, enhancing the membrane's properties. The resulting porous PTFE membrane is designed to have a water permeability of at least about 0.5 l/hr/m²/kPa, making it suitable for various applications.
